Stores That Don’t Gift Wrap
Athleta: You can’t have your gifts wrapped, but you can send a free personal message to the person you’re giving the gift to.
Banana Republic: The store no longer offers gift wrapping, but you can send a free message to a gift recipient with your order.
Bath & Body Works doesn’t offer gift wrapping, but you can buy a gift bag for $1 and include a free gift message with your online order.
Big Lots: The store does not offer online gift wrapping or packaging.
Costco: When you check out, you can add a personalized gift message to certain items.
You can send your order as a gift, but Dick’s Sporting Goods doesn’t wrap gifts.
Foot Locker: Neither in stores nor online, the kick store doesn’t offer gift wrapping.
JCPenney doesn’t offer gift wrapping.
Jonathan Adler: There is no gift-wrapping service.
Kohl’s: You can’t buy gifts online and have them wrapped, but you can add a personal note to any gift you buy.
Lord & Taylor: The store doesn’t do gift wrapping.
With your online order from Lululemon, you can send a free gift message.
Old Navy: With every online gift order, you can send a free, personalized message.
Target: If you buy a gift online at Target, you can add a free gift message at checkout.
Customers who shop online at TJ Maxx can add a gift receipt to their order.
Walmart: You can hide prices and get a digital receipt from the store, but your gift order will be sent in a Walmart box at no extra cost.
How Can I Get Gifts Wrapped At Walmart?

There is not a single Walmart location that offers gift-wrapping services. On the other hand, you have the option of having the items that you buy online presented in gift packaging.
Keep an eye out for the “gift eligible” icon that should be located underneath the product that you wish to buy when you are browsing for presents on Walmart.com or through the Walmart gift finder. This enables the product to be packaged up before it is shipped out for delivery.
If you select the option to have a product wrapped, it will be delivered in a gift box from Walmart along with a unique greeting that you may compose before you complete your purchase.
You have the option of sending the recipient of your gift a digital gift receipt in the event that they need to return or exchange the present they received from you.
How Can I Send Wrapped Gifts From Walmart?
Simply navigate to your basket on the Walmart website after you have chosen the products that are suitable for gift wrapping, and then click the button that says “My order is a gift.”
After you have completed those steps, you will be prompted to choose a delivery method and provide the recipient’s email address as well as their physical delivery address. After that, you will be given the option to include a personalized message with your present.
After reaching this page, you will proceed through the checkout process as usual, and the cost of gift wrapping and personalization will be waived for products that qualify.

When Did Walmart Stores Stop Wrapping Gifts?
After the year 2015, Walmart stores no longer provided gift-wrapping services in-store.
Their in-store gift wrapping service was among the most reasonably priced of the big stores and supermarkets, costing only $3.88 for each item that customers desired to have wrapped. Your things would be packaged in a blue box and tied with a white ribbon before being sent to you.
Even though Walmart no longer offers a service in which they wrap your products for you, you can still buy a large variety of gift wrap supplies there or online. These supplies are available in both locations.
Where Can I Go To Get Something Gift Wrapped?

There are a lot of stores that offer a service where they will wrap your presents for you if that is something that you would like. Although some retail establishments provide the service at no cost, many others charge a nominal price for it. These are the following:
- Barnes & Noble
- Bed Bath & Beyond
- Nordstrom
- Ralph Lauren
- Sephora
- Tiffany & Co
- Williams-Sonoma
- Bloomingdale’s
If you go somewhere that charges for its gift-wrapping services, you shouldn’t expect to pay more than $5 for each item that you want to have wrapped.
Keep in mind that the vast majority of stores that offer gift-wrapping services will only gift-wrap products that you have purchased from that particular retailer.
